 Dear HOT Community,

As many of us are looking forward to a relaxing weekend, unfortunately many
others will be evacuated from their homes, uncertain if it will still be
there when they are allowed to return. In many places, including here in
the U.S. not far from my own home, there are large wildfires. We know we
will not be able to have a meaningful response and impact in all of these
incidents. However, in the case of Algeria - the local community is trying
to do something, but they need our help. So, by their request, the
Activation Working Group and Disaster Services Team are Activating to
support the efforts of OSM Algeria to generate base data for the most
impacted areas in their country.

We also have great partnerships in the region and are looking for ways we
can collaborate on response and recovery efforts around the Mediterranean.
As this response is just getting launched, we ask that you stay tuned. We
are most responsive on the HOT Slack <http://slack.hotosm.org>
#disaster-mapping channel, or to the AWG and DST emails cc'd on this
message.

*How You Can Help!* - We have launched an Intermediate difficulty project
to map buildings near Toudja, Algeria. Beginners are welcome, just note
there are some dense areas and existing mapping; please select appropriate
tasks and leave the more difficult ones for advanced mappers. Find this
